About Alabama Stonewall Democrats
Alabama Stonewall Democrats (ASD) is Alabama's largest lesbian and gay political club. Founded in 2005, we promote social change by electing fair-minded leaders.
We Elect Equality.
For nearly a decade, ASD has been the political voice of Alabama’s LGBT community. We have been building relationships with elected officials, endorsing and supporting LGBT and pro-equality candidates for public office, speaking out against bigotry and violence, fighting for marriage equality, advocating for the rights and services of people living with HIV and AIDS, lobbying elected officials for civil rights, registering voters, educating voters about LGBT issues and about candidates' positions, and building a coalition of LGBT, pro-equality, and progressive political allies.
Today, we have over 1,000 members, supporters and friends, in addition to a core of hard-working volunteers who keep ASD focused on the issues most important to the LGBT residents of Alabama.
